Power Electronics Team Lead

Astranis Space Technologies builds advanced satellites for high orbits, expanding humanity’s reach into the solar system. The Power Electronics Team Lead will manage and grow a team of engineers, overseeing the design and implementation of power converters and systems for geo-synchronous spacecraft.

Responsibilities

Directly manage and grow a team of junior and senior power engineers
Collaborate with a broad and multidisciplinary team to define the spacecraft power requirements and architectures
Oversee the design, build, and implementation of the power converters and systems
Manage a detailed schedule to ensure that our power converters and systems development is in sync with the overall program schedule
Drive power converter design, specification, component selection, circuit board design, implementation, verification, board bring-up, and debugging
Support in recruiting, interviewing, and hiring additional teammates to our rapidly-growing team
Support the production and mission operations teams on the build and in-flight use of our power converter hardware
Drive the growth of the power team through recruiting, interviewing, and hiring additional teammates to our rapidly-expanding team

Qualification

Power electronics designHardware developmentTeam managementBoard level experienceFast-paced product designPhotovoltaics experienceLi-ion battery managementMagnetics in power electronicsRadiation effects knowledgeRecruiting skillsPassion for hardwareCommunication skillsProblem-solving skillsCollaboration skills

Required

B.S. or higher in electrical engineering, or similar technical degree
5+ years of professional experience with fast-paced product design cycles
5+ years of board level experience designing power electronics hardware from concept through production
A passion for hardware development, including working in a fast-paced environment and hands-on design and development
Demonstrated ability to design, build, and test hardware from scratch
Demonstrated ability to build and manage teams of engineers and communicate clearly with other disciplines
US Citizenship or Green Card

Preferred

Experience with photovoltaics
Experience with Li-ion batteries and management systems
Experience with magnetics in power electronics
Radiation effects knowledge
